HVAC Repair Costs in Columbia Station

Typical heating and cooling repair costs in Columbia Station, by component.

ServiceLowAverageHigh
Diagnostic / service call
$83$132$220
Thermostat replacement
$165$303$550
Blower motor replacement
$440$715$1,210
Heat exchanger replacement
$1,650$2,420$3,850
Ignitor replacement (gas furnace)
$165$275$440
Control board replacement
$330$605$990
Full system repair (major)
Multi-component failure
$550$1,320$3,300

Prices reflect continental metro averages compiled from published industry cost guides, contractor surveys, and regional labor data. Last updated: April 2026.

HVAC Repair in Columbia Station, OH: What to Expect

Living just outside Cleveland in Columbia Station means dealing with the full range of Great Lakes weather. Summers push into the 80s with uncomfortable humidity, while winters drop to a chilly 22 degrees on average, complete with lake-effect snow that keeps heating systems working hard from October through April. The cooling season runs a solid three months from June to August, meaning local homeowners need reliable HVAC Repair in Columbia Station to stay comfortable year-round. Five contractors serve this area, and the average rating sits at 3.9 stars across 156 reviews, with four of them offering around-the-clock emergency service.

When something breaks, Columbia Station homeowners can expect to pay between $83 and $220 for a diagnostic service call, while a thermostat replacement typically runs $165 to $550 and a blower motor replacement ranges from $440 to $1,210. Ohio law requires all HVAC contractors to hold a valid license from the Ohio Construction Industry Licensing Board, ensuring that anyone working on your system has met the state's training and competency standards.
